21
22 #include "reg.h"
23 #include "ps.h"
24 #include "cmd.h"
25 #include "io.h"
26
27 /* in ms */
28 #define WL1251_WAKEUP_TIMEOUT 100
29
30 void wl1251_elp_work(struct work_struct *work)
31 {
32         struct delayed_work *dwork;
33         struct wl1251 *wl;
34
35         dwork = container_of(work, struct delayed_work, work);
36         wl = container_of(dwork, struct wl1251, elp_work);
37
38         wl1251_debug(DEBUG_PSM, "elp work");
39
40         mutex_lock(&wl->mutex);
41
42         if (wl->elp || !wl->psm)
43                 goto out;
44
45         wl1251_debug(DEBUG_PSM, "chip to elp");
46         wl1251_write_elp(wl, HW_ACCESS_ELP_CTRL_REG_ADDR, ELPCTRL_SLEEP);
47         wl->elp = true;
48
49 out:
50         mutex_unlock(&wl->mutex);
51 }
52
53 #define ELP_ENTRY_DELAY  5
54
55 /* Routines to toggle sleep mode while in ELP */
56 void wl1251_ps_elp_sleep(struct wl1251 *wl)
57 {
58         unsigned long delay;
59
60         if (wl->psm) {
61                 delay = msecs_to_jiffies(ELP_ENTRY_DELAY);
62                 ieee80211_queue_delayed_work(wl->hw, &wl->elp_work, delay);
63         }
64 }
65
66 int wl1251_ps_elp_wakeup(struct wl1251 *wl)
67 {
68         unsigned long timeout, start;
69         u32 elp_reg;
70
71         if (delayed_work_pending(&wl->elp_work))
72                 cancel_delayed_work(&wl->elp_work);
73
74         if (!wl->elp)
75                 return 0;
76
77         wl1251_debug(DEBUG_PSM, "waking up chip from elp");
78
79         start = jiffies;
80         timeout = jiffies + msecs_to_jiffies(WL1251_WAKEUP_TIMEOUT);
81
82         wl1251_write_elp(wl, HW_ACCESS_ELP_CTRL_REG_ADDR, ELPCTRL_WAKE_UP);
83
84         elp_reg = wl1251_read_elp(wl, HW_ACCESS_ELP_CTRL_REG_ADDR);
85
86         /*
87          * FIXME: we should wait for irq from chip but, as a temporary
88          * solution to simplify locking, let's poll instead
89          */
90         while (!(elp_reg & ELPCTRL_WLAN_READY)) {
91                 if (time_after(jiffies, timeout)) {
92                         wl1251_error("elp wakeup timeout");
93                         return -ETIMEDOUT;
94                 }
95                 msleep(1);
96                 elp_reg = wl1251_read_elp(wl, HW_ACCESS_ELP_CTRL_REG_ADDR);
97         }
98
99         wl1251_debug(DEBUG_PSM, "wakeup time: %u ms",
100                      jiffies_to_msecs(jiffies - start));
101
102         wl->elp = false;
103
104         return 0;
105 }
106
107 int wl1251_ps_set_mode(struct wl1251 *wl, enum wl1251_cmd_ps_mode mode)
108 {
109         int ret;
110
111         switch (mode) {
112         case STATION_POWER_SAVE_MODE:
113                 wl1251_debug(DEBUG_PSM, "entering psm");
114
115                 /* enable beacon filtering */
116                 ret = wl1251_acx_beacon_filter_opt(wl, true);
117                 if (ret < 0)
118                         return ret;
119
120                 ret = wl1251_acx_wake_up_conditions(wl,
121                                                     WAKE_UP_EVENT_DTIM_BITMAP,
122                                                     wl->listen_int);
123                 if (ret < 0)
124                         return ret;
125
126                 ret = wl1251_acx_bet_enable(wl, WL1251_ACX_BET_ENABLE,
127                                             WL1251_DEFAULT_BET_CONSECUTIVE);
128                 if (ret < 0)
129                         return ret;
130
131                 ret = wl1251_cmd_ps_mode(wl, STATION_POWER_SAVE_MODE);
132                 if (ret < 0)
133                         return ret;
134
135                 ret = wl1251_acx_sleep_auth(wl, WL1251_PSM_ELP);
136                 if (ret < 0)
137                         return ret;
138
139                 wl->psm = 1;
140                 break;
141         case STATION_ACTIVE_MODE:
142         default:
143                 wl1251_debug(DEBUG_PSM, "leaving psm");
144
145                 ret = wl1251_acx_sleep_auth(wl, WL1251_PSM_CAM);
146                 if (ret < 0)
147                         return ret;
148
149                 /* disable BET */
150                 ret = wl1251_acx_bet_enable(wl, WL1251_ACX_BET_DISABLE,
151                                             WL1251_DEFAULT_BET_CONSECUTIVE);
152                 if (ret < 0)
153                         return ret;
154
155                 /* disable beacon filtering */
156                 ret = wl1251_acx_beacon_filter_opt(wl, false);
157                 if (ret < 0)
158                         return ret;
159
160                 ret = wl1251_acx_wake_up_conditions(wl,
161                                                     WAKE_UP_EVENT_DTIM_BITMAP,
162                                                     wl->listen_int);
163                 if (ret < 0)
164                         return ret;
165
166                 ret = wl1251_cmd_ps_mode(wl, STATION_ACTIVE_MODE);
167                 if (ret < 0)
168                         return ret;
169
170                 wl->psm = 0;
171                 break;
172         }
173
174         return ret;
175 }
